“Before the Wedding,” by Lenore Chinn. A portrait of artist Kim Anno (seated) and her partner Ellen Meyers. Acrylic on canvas, 2000.“When I look at the painting now, I am struck by what a formal painting it is. I am almost shocked by that, because I have always associated formal portraits with aristocracy — and who am I to be sitting for a formal aristocratic portrait? In another way, also, the portrait is transgressive. After all, we’re two women, not a married couple. Well, we’re married, but not like a heterosexual married couple. … It really takes on something about lesbian life, and the seriousness of one’s relationship, which, in our case, is a transracial relationship. There’s a lot of multi-layering references in the painting …” — Kim Anno(Courtesy of Lenore Chinn) -- source link
